Joint inflammation, or arthritis, refers to the swelling, pain, and stiffness that affect one or more joints in the body. This condition can be acute or chronic and is often accompanied by symptoms such as redness, warmth, and decreased range of motion in the affected joints. Joint inflammation can result from a variety of causes. Common types include osteoarthritis, which is a degenerative joint disease caused by the breakdown of cartilage over time; rheumatoid arthritis, an autoimmune disorder where the immune system attacks the synovial lining of the joints; and gout, a condition caused by the buildup of uric acid crystals in the joints. Other causes include infections, which can lead to septic arthritis, and traumatic injuries that result in joint damage.
Treatment for joint inflammation focuses on alleviating symptoms and managing the underlying cause. For osteoarthritis, treatment may involve physical therapy, weight management, and medications such as analgesics or n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) to relieve pain and inflammation. Rheumatoid arthritis may be managed with disease-modifying antirheumatic drugs (DMARDs) and biologic agents to slow disease progression and control inflammation. Gout is typically treated with medications to lower uric acid levels and manage acute attacks. In cases of infectious arthritis, antibiotics or antiviral medications are used to address the infection. Joint injections with corticosteroids can provide temporary relief for inflammation and pain. Additionally, lifestyle modifications, such as regular exercise and joint protection strategies, can help maintain joint function and reduce symptoms. For severe cases or when other treatments are ineffective, surgical interventions such as joint repair or replacement may be considered. Consulting a healthcare provider for an accurate diagnosis and individualized treatment plan is essential for effective management of joint inflammation.
